What to check before choosing a high-rise building near the N train in All Upper West Side

  • Expect mostly larger, multi-unit buildings (15+ floors) and confirm the elevator setup, laundry in-building, and move-in logistics early.
  • Before touring, verify what “near the N train” means for your commute by checking the exact cross streets and walking time during off-peak hours.
  • Ask about building policies that often vary by property: package handling, bike storage, and any rules for storage lockers or common areas.
  • If you’re sensitive to noise, request details on street-facing exposure and ask whether there are building-wide quiet hours or construction notifications.
  • Use the Openigloo signals to narrow options, then confirm current availability, rent, fees, and lease terms with the building directly. If you need specific unit features, filter by your must-haves after you shortlist.
